A Professional Certificate in Conflict Resolution for Student Representation equips students with the essential skills to navigate disagreements effectively within educational settings. This program focuses on developing practical strategies for mediation, negotiation, and collaborative problem-solving.
Learning outcomes include mastering active listening techniques, understanding different conflict styles, and applying appropriate conflict resolution models to diverse student situations. Graduates will be adept at facilitating constructive dialogue and mediating disputes among peers, fostering a positive and productive learning environment. The curriculum also incorporates relevant legal frameworks and ethical considerations.
The duration of the certificate program is typically short, often ranging from a few weeks to a few months of intensive study, making it a manageable commitment for busy students. The flexible online learning options available often cater to various schedules.
